1900.3610 MINNESOTA STATE ARTS BOARD/REGIONAL ARTS COUNCIL LIAISON COMMITTEE.

Subpart 1.

Purpose of liaison committee.

The Minnesota State Arts Board/Regional Arts Council Liaison Committee shall serve in an advisory capacity to the board on matters that affect the regional arts councils and the Regional Arts Council Forum. Specific responsibilities include:

A.

advising the board on the administration of regional arts council functions in regions where there is no designated regional arts council;

B.

hearing and making recommendations to the board about disputes between the board and a regional arts council or the Regional Arts Council Forum;

C.

identifying and working cooperatively to address issues of common interest or concern to the board, forum, and the regional arts councils; and

D.

other responsibilities as assigned by the board.

Subp. 2.

Member appointment.

The liaison committee shall be a board committee composed of seven members. Three members shall be appointed by the board from the board membership and three members shall be appointed by the Regional Arts Council Forum from the forum membership. The executive director of the board shall serve as a nonvoting member of the committee.
